The A64 sequence table is populated by registration statics spread across
multiple translation units. Keeping the backing map as a global object makes
registration depend on cross-TU initialization order and can hit the table
before it has been constructed.
Move the sequence table behind a function-local static so sequence
registration is safe regardless of which unit initializes first.
